What Are Dry Storage Containers?
Dry storage containers, frequently called Shipping Container Housing containers, are robust metal boxes designed for transferring items by road, rail, or sea. They provide a protected and weatherproof environment, securing cargo from external elements. Unlike refrigerated containers specifically created for perishable products, dry storage containers are dry on the inside and safe for keeping a vast array of merchandise.

Dry storage containers use several benefits that make them a preferred option for numerous markets. Some key benefits include:

Durability and Security: Made from state-of-the-art steel, dry storage containers are developed to withstand severe environmental conditions. They likewise come equipped with locking mechanisms for included security.

Versatility: These containers can save a large range of products, including machinery, tools, furnishings, and customer items, making them ideal for various applications.

Mobility: Dry storage containers are quickly portable by truck, train, or ship, enabling companies to move their items effectively across various modes of transport.

Cost-Effectiveness: Unlike conventional storage facilities, dry storage containers can be leased or purchased for a lower general cost, making them a smart choice for organizations wanting to save money.

Customizability: Containers can be modified to match specific storage requirements, such as adding shelving, windows, or ventilation systems.
